Auckland International Airport has released its passenger traffic figures for February, showing a surge in domestic traffic, while international traffic also showed strong growth.
Domestic traffic through the airport increased by 10.8 per cent for the month, which was attributed to Jetstar replacing Qantas’s domestic services, while domestic movements increased by 0.5 per cent. International passenger traffic increased by 4.6 per cent (excluding transit passengers), which was aided by strong growth on trans-Tasman routes, particularly to Sydney and the Gold Coast.
